VENUS:

O.E., from L. Venus (pl. veneres), in ancient Roman mythology, the goddess of beauty and love, especially sensual love,

  • from venus "love, sexual desire, loveliness, beauty, charm,"

  • from PIE base *wen- "to strive after, wish, desire, be satisfied"

    • cf. Skt. vanas- "desire," vanati "desires, loves, wins;"

    • cf. Avestan vanaiti "The wishes, is victorious"

    • cf. O.E. wynn "joy," wunian "to dwell," wenian "to accustom, train wean," wyscan (ween) "to wish"

  • Applied by the Romans to Gk. Aphrodite, Egyptian Hathor, etc.

  • Meaning "second planet from the sun" is attested from c.1290 (O.E. had morgensteorra and æfensteorra).

Zukra

  • bright , resplendent

  • clear , pure, spotless

  • light-colored , white

  • brightness , clearness , light

  • Name of Agni or fire

  • Name of a month (Jyestha = May-June , personified as the guardian of Kubera's treasure)

  • clear or pure Soma ; receptacle for Soma

  • Any clear liquid (as water , Soma etc.)

  • juice , the essence of anything

  • semen virile , seed of animals (male and female) , sperm

  • a morbid affection of the iris (change of color etc. accompanied by imperfect vision

  • A good action

  • gold , wealth

A marAri

  • A n enemy of the gods; an Asura

  • Name of Shukra , the planet Venus

A suraguru

  • Teacher of the Asuras

bha

  • semblance , delusion , error

  • A ppearance , resemblance , likeness

  • A star , planet , asterism , lunar asterism or mansion (and so also the number 27 nakshatra)

  • light or a beam of light , luster , splendor

bhRgu

  • name of a mythical race of beings (closely connected with fire); they are also said to fabricate chariots

  • Shukra or the planet Venus (called either Bhrigu or the son of Bhrigu [bhriguputra] ; his day is Friday)

  • Of Krishna or of Rudra

  • a declivity , slope , precipice

bhArgava

  • relating to or coming from Bhrigu

  • descendants of Bhrigu

bhArgavapriya

  • A diamond

ekekSaNa

  • "one-eyed"; name of Shukra or Venus (the teacher of the Asuras)

maghAbhava

  • Offspring of Magha

  • The planet Venus

Venus isn't really the *Love* planet; Shukra is the Pleasure Planet

All benefic graha provide positive loving support to human life, but Shukra's "love" is not divine - it's inter-human:

  • Venus rules attraction to pleasures and distraction by pleasures. Shukra provides human sensual experience that claims our profound devotion and attention. Shukra rules human-to-human contracts, love-making in the pursuit of mutual pleasure, and all forms of alliance for the purpose of enhancement of mutual interests (particularly mutual financial interests.)

  • Moon rules pure and unconditional mother-love, shelter and protection. Chandra has profound needs and expectations, but the parent-child relationship is not equal-to-equal. Soma has no contracts.

  • Surya rules truth, which is the purest form of the supreme love of the divine. It is not possible to negotiate with the truth.

  • Guru is all-embracing, all-encompassing, and utterly non-discriminating; Guru has no contracts. The dharma includes all. Guru accepts all.

Venus= the karaka for marriage, sexual relationships, promises and agreements, exchanges of equal value, and understandings toward mutual benefit.

Marriage = the "ultimate contract".

  • Marriage = attraction between two parties who expect each other to provide interactive interpersonal benefit. Marriage alliance is also a social contract.

  • Affection in marriage is contractual, depending on multiple levels of agreement (private services provided in exchange for protection, fulfillment of public expectation, etc.)

The "love" of Shukra is not unconditional like mother-child love, nor transcendent like devotee-deity (sometimes, guru-sisya) love. Shukra's marital love is the result of attraction to sensual pleasures. As a result, Shukra is not really the "love" planet at all, but a rather misleading and even fraudulent substitute for pure love.

Sensual experience isn't really love. That is why Shukra is called A suraguru = "Guru of the Demons".

    Shukra and Career


    from B. V. Raman, ACatechism of Astrology, p. 9 - part II page 2:


    "Q. What makes one an actor or a singer?

    A.

    • Generally Venus will have to be strong in the horoscope before one can be a good actor or singer.

    • If this is to be adopted as profession, Venus must be intimately connected with the 10th bhava in some way or other.

    • E.g., if Venus occupies 4th or 10th Bhava or if Venus aspects the 10th house or if Venus is conjoined with the lord of the 10th, his means of livelihood will be singer and acting.

    Q. What makes one an engineer?

    A.

    • If in a nativity, Venus becomes the strongest planet with reference to the 10th Bhava,

    • And occupies powerful places from Lagna and the Moon, and joins Mercury,

    • The native becomes an engineer."

    [BP Lama notes: Shukra rules buildings and artistic or structural design, whilst Mars rules the Land]
